Protecting Medical Imaging Data with Blockchain Technology

One of the primary applications of a Postgraduate Certificate in Medical Imaging Data Security is the use of blockchain technology to safeguard medical imaging data. Blockchain's decentralized and immutable nature makes it an attractive solution for securing sensitive data. By utilizing blockchain-based systems, healthcare organizations can ensure the integrity and confidentiality of medical imaging data, preventing unauthorized access and tampering. For instance, a study published in the Journal of Medical Systems demonstrated the feasibility of using blockchain technology to secure electronic health records (EHRs) and medical imaging data.
